RALPH FISCHER
Ralph K. Fischer, 73, of 11 Church St., North Warren, died Saturday, Dec. 18, 2004, at Duke University Hospital, Durham, N.C.
He was born Dec. 23, 1930, in Warren, the son of the late Simon and Emma Gertsch Fischer. He was a 1948 graduate of Warren High School, and served in the U.S. Army during World War II. Mr. Fischer was a credit manager for United Refining Co. for over 30 years, retiring in 1993. He was a member of the North Warren United Presbyterian Church, North Star Masonic Lodge F and AM, Coudersport Consistory, Shriners, American Legion Post No.135, and the Kiwanas Club.
He is survived by three sons, Danford W. Fischer, Las Vegas, Nev., Kevin A. Fischer, Baltimore, Md., and Scott D. Fischer, Warren; a daughter, Lori Crooks, Hillsborough, N.C.; a sister, Ruth Franklin, Lakewood, N.Y.; seven grandchildren; and several nieces and nephews.
Friends may call at the Peterson-Blick Funeral Home, Inc., from 7-9 p.m. Wednesday. Members of the North Star Masonic Lodge will conduct their ritual at 6:45 p.m. A funeral service will be held there at 11 a.m. Thursdasy with Rev. Burfoot S. Ward, III, pastor, North Warren Presbyterian Church, officiating. Burial will be in Warren County Memorial Park. Memorial contributions may be made to the American Cancer Society.
